June 11 - The importance of Brazil in the shipping and oil & gas sector has prompted the GAC Group to establish its latest port agency operation, with its coordination office at Rio de Janeiro.

From there, GAC Brazil's experienced team will liaise with a network of approved sub-agents to offer a wide range of port agency services, husbandry services, crew changes, medical assistance and provisions at all major Brazilian ports. 

Recent development in Brazil's economy and industrial sector has boosted demand for a first class ship agency and related services. As part of the GAC Group, a global provider of shipping logistics and marine services, GAC Brazil has the expertise, experience and resources to meet that demand. 

"We operate in a world where clients want more integrated service packages and the savings that comes out of it. GAC Brazil aims to provide differentiated shipping and logistics services to its principals and clients, which will guarantee the maximum efficiency in our services for shipping and logistics business, "says Rodrigo De Marco, GAC Brazil managing director. 

The company also meets the needs of the burgeoning energy sector for mobilization, demobilisation, offshore support and crew transfers, as well as sectors like dry bulk, general cargo, tankers and ro-ro. And for door-to-deck delivery of parts, its designated ships spares logistics department provides nationwide coverage. 

The new GAC operation offers a well-established full range of logistics services that includes air, sea, road, ship spares and project cargo logistics, customs clearance and bonded warehousing.
